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Ratón Alpino | Gebe Cuscus |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(cordados) | Chordata (cordados) |
| Class same | Mammalia (mamíferos) | Mammalia (mamíferos)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Diprotodontia (Marsupials) |
| Family | Muridae (Mice & Rats) | Phalangeridae |
| Genus | Apodemus | Phalanger |
| Species | Apodemus alpicola | Phalanger alexandrae |
Evolutionary Relationship
Ratón Alpino and Gebe Cuscus share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(mamíferos)
